After 4 months, I've finally completed my arrangement of Osvald's theme! I was originally using my white Ibanez RG 350 to record the rhythm parts, but it still has intonation problems, and has old strings, so I decided to re-learn the parts on my 8-string (I used an asinine tuning to do it involving tuning most of the guitar UP a half-step from standard, except the highest two strings, so that I can easily play a really spicy Cmin9 chord lol)
I had mentioned a track from this game that I was doing for the Pixel Mixers arrangement album a couple times, so just to make it clear, this isn't the same one. Once that one is officially released, I will post the video for it on my channel.
For this arrangement, I took some liberties with the song by adding some spicy riffs/ostinatos to the A section, since it's very minimal in the original, and doesn't give me a ton to work with. So I kept the chord progression and melody the same, but just added some of my own tidbits, if you will. The B or "chorus" section is more or less like the original without any added tidbits, aside from the last part towards the end having a very polyrhythmic feel that shifts the melody over a bit at times.

This one took quite a while to come out, and Im super glad I can finally share this one with everyone! This was a cover I did for Dwelling of Duels back in June, but the version I posted there is a bit different from this one, as it only features myself, but this one features the amazing Fuzz Pixels, and is arguably the better version as a result! :)
For this song, I thought it would be a fun idea to up the tempo quite a bit and give it more of a pop punk kind of vibe (although with more of the riffy metal style that I tend to do). Since Fuzz Pixels does a lot of Punk/Punk-adjacent covers, I thought it was the perfect song to feature him on, and he did a great job playing the melodies in his own unique way, not to mention the really tasty solo he came up with!
